Adding a pump session-when?

Over the past few weeks I haven't pumped enough for LO's daycare bottles. I am using my freezer stash to make up the difference. I'm getting 8-9oz and I need 12oz. On a typical day I nurse her at home at 530am, 730am, I pump at work at 10am, 1pm, and 4pm and I nurse her to sleep at 7pm. She is usually down by 730/745pm. I go to bed around 930/10. During my two hours of free time before I go bed I have some wine. I don't know when to add in a pumping session. I don't want to have to give up having my wine. When should I pump?
